Further development As Club work developed, it became increasingly clear
that it was very important to establish co-operation between private (Clubs of
alcoholics in treatment) and public (social and health institutions) activities.
In 1987, prof. Hudolin suggested the foundation of Functional Alcohol Centres
for organising this kind of work in Italy. Since then, many Alcohol Centres were founded in Italy, with various names and belonging
to various organisations, more or less functionally or organically formed.

professional level. In recent years clubs have begun to pay special
attention to multidimensional suffering. We observed multidimensional problems
in alcoholics families a long time ago, but we began to address them in the last
ten years. The most frequent combination of difficulties are simultaneously
connected to mental and psychiatric disorders, to using other psychoactive
substances, usually called drug addiction, to spiritual and existential
difficulties, aggressive and violent behaviour, risky behaviour and the problems
of single, skid row and homeless alcoholics. In order to organise the Club work
to include this multidimensional suffering, special courses are held in Italy to
educate servant-teachers and Club members for work with these people and prepare
them to accept such families. |
